What this inspection record means

OSHA opens inspections for many reasons — routine scheduling under a national or local emphasis program, an employee complaint or referral, or a follow-up after a reported injury. Opening or conducting an inspection is not itself an allegation or a finding that this employer broke any rule; any findings appear as the citations listed below, and citations can be contested, reduced, or withdrawn.

29 CFR 1926.405(g)(2)(iii): Flexible cords were not used in continuous lengths without splice or tap.      On or about October 22, 2012, employees, engaged in framing activities on a residential construction site, utilized an air-compressor with the power cord spliced to an extension cord exposing employees to electrical hazards.

29 CFR 1926.501(b)(1): Each employee on a walking/working surface with an unprotected side or edge which was 6 feet (1.8 m) or more above a lower level was not protected from falling by the use of guardrail systems, safety net systems, or personal fall arrest systems.      On or about October 22, 2012, employees were exposed to a fall hazards of approximately 12 feet while engaged in framing activities on a residential construction site.
